Output e90dfbeea307a87f5988e31ffb39c45e2d719e7c7b312720a263b7bb72129bec:2

value
2091339
script pubkey
OP_0 OP_PUSHBYTES_20 eb13c5f4ae03b2b0e7bdbfc1a22ec623a1b4d302
address
bc1qavfuta9wqwetpeaahlq6ytkxywsmf5cz5mgrzu
transaction
e90dfbeea307a87f5988e31ffb39c45e2d719e7c7b312720a263b7bb72129bec
spent
true